The Remarkable Mr. Deen

An exhibit dedicated to honoring the life of a Garden Spot teacher and founder of the Garden Spot Performing Arts program. A tribute to the man that positively influenced the lives of thousands of students and members of our community.

The story of The New Holland Machine Company

An exhibit detailing the amazing history of the New Holland Machine Company, a simple business that started locally and grew into a company known across the world for its production of machines that greatly increased the productivity and efficiency of agriculture.

New Holland Area Historical Society thanks “our neighbors!”

An exhibit that honors the townships of Brecknock, Caenarvon, Earl and East Earl. The exhibit features maps, brief histories, and photos of historic structures and memorable individuals from each area.
